Responsibilities:

  1. Audits all processed transactions within the section to maintain accuracy.
  2. Reviews and processes all documents and answers employee’s inquiries related to employee’s benefits and contracts.
  3. Guides and trains Personnel staff, orients new employees, assists with performance evaluations of section’s staff as required.
  4. Ensures that proper and sufficient materials are available. Ensures that all equipment’s are functioning properly and takes remedial action to correct deficiencies.
  5. Processes interdepartmental transfers and promotions of employees.
  6. Meets with employees to discuss policy and benefits. Assists and directs employees for further assistance if necessary.
  7. Organizes and analyses documents to determine employee eligibility for benefits.
  8. Assists and directs Personnel Analyst regarding workloads. Ensures that output is completed in timely and proper manner.
  9. Reviews and recommends suggestions to update the IPP.
  10. Assists with development of software for Personnel transactions.
  11. Answers all inquiries related to the Oracle System testing phase.
  12. Tests transactions in the Oracle System in coordination with HITA and HR super users.

    1. Documents of the Oracle System testing and the auditing process.

    • Notifies departments about employees attaining Mandatory Retirement Age.
    • Follows all Hospital’s related Policies and Procedures.
    • Participates in self and others’ education, training and development, as applicable.
    • Performs other related duties as assigned.
